(1905–1961) was a Swedish diplomat who served as the second Secretary-General of the United Nations. Known for his integrity and commitment to peace, he played a crucial role in international diplomacy during a tense period of the Cold War. Hammarskjöld worked to strengthen the independence and effectiveness of the UN, often mediating conflicts and promoting humanitarian efforts. He was posthumously awarded the Nobel Peace Prize in 1961. His writings, particularly "Markings," reveal a deeply reflective and philosophical mind. Dag Hammarskjöld remains a symbol of ethical leadership and dedication to global peace.
